Description

The feeling of heavy legs is caused by multiple factors, including lifestyle, working conditions, current diet and hormonal problems (menstruation, menopause...).

Hübner Venenkraft gel 100ml is a gel that helps to activate and improve venous circulation in the legs, thus reducing the feeling of fatigue and tiredness in the legs. It is made from natural extracts of Horse Chestnut, Hamamelis, Arnica, Camphor, Menthol, Lemon and Lavender oil.

This gel helps to soothe symptoms related to tired legs such as heaviness, numbness, cramps and swelling of legs, ankles and feet

Instructions for use

It is recommended to apply the gel with a gentle massage once or twice a day then keeping legs elevated for a few minutes.

Pharmaceutical Advice

Arnica (Arnica montana) is a plant with anti-inflammatory, analgesic and antibacterial properties. It has been used topically (on the skin) since ancient times when macerations were made with its flowers as a natural remedy.

Arnica extract relieves muscular discomfort, and small bruises, and is useful in supporting muscle and joint recovery after physical exercise. It also has antiseptic properties.

In cosmetics, it helps to reduce small bruises or swelling after dermatological treatments.

It is not recommended for people who are hypersensitive to plants of the Compositae family. It should not be applied directly to open wounds.

Depending on the concentration, it is not recommended during pregnancy and breastfeeding (except for some cosmetics tested at this stage and with low concentrations). When in doubt, consult a healthcare professional.
